Finite Dimensional Generating Spaces of Quasi-Norm Family

In this paper,~some results on finite dimensional generating spaces of quasi-norm family are established.~The idea of equivalent quasi-norm families is introduced.~Riesz lemma is established in this space.~Finally,~we re-define B-S fuzzy norm and prove that it induces a generating space of quasi-norm family.

Generating Binary Trees by Transpositions

Let T(n) denote the set of all bitstrings with n 1's and n 0's that satisfy the property that in every preex the number of 0's does not exceed the number of 1's. This is a well known representation of binary trees. Generating Binary Trees at Random

Atkinson, M.D. and J.-R. Sack, Generating binary trees at random, Information Processing Letters 41 (1992) 21-23. We give a new constructive proof of the Chung-Feller theorem. Our proof provides a new and simple linear-time algorithm for generating random binary trees on n nodes; the algorithm uses integers no larger than 212.

N-Dimensional Binary Vector Spaces

The binary set {0, 1} together with modulo-2 addition and multiplication is called a binary field, which is denoted by F2. The binary field F2 is defined in [1]. A vector space over F2 is called a binary vector space. The set of all binary vectors of length n forms an n-dimensional vector space Vn over F2.
